SB 284 introduced by Senator Lyda Green would designate seats on the Board of Fish. Senate Resources heard the bill this week and accepted a committee substitute and held the bill for another hearing. The CS language now reads (full legislation not copied here)
The board consists of
(1) two members who represent commercial fishing interests and who do not hold and do not have an immediate family member who holds (A) a sport fishing operator license under AS 16.40.260; (charter) or (B) a sport fishing guide license under AS 16.40.270
(2) three members who represent personal use or subsistence fishing interests and who (A) do not hold and do not have an immediate family member who holds (i) a commercial fishing permit or crewmember permit under AS 16.05.480; (ii) a sport fishing operator license under AS 16.40.260; or (iii) a sport fishing guide license under AS 16.40.270 or (B) do not own or have an immediate family member who owns a commercial fish processing business;
(3) two members who represent sport fishing interests and who (A) do not hold and do not have an immediate family member who holds a commercial fishing permit or crewmember permit under AS 16.05.480; or (B) do not own or have an immediate family member who owns a commercial fish processing business.

(e) in this section, "immediate family member" means (1) the spouse or domestic partner of the member; or (2) a parent, child, including a stepchild and an adoptive child or sibling of the member if the parent, child, or sibling resides with the member, is financially dependent on the member, or shares a substantial financial interest with the member.

During the hearing that was held the following testimony was heard:
For support of the bill
1. The commercial fishermen control the Board of Fish
2. Need a board of fish that is fair
3. Sport fish/PU/Subsistence does not have a voice on the Board of Fish
4. Local Advisory committees have designated seats for different users
5. It's all about allocation and we'll fight until we get new people that will see things our way

Comments opposing the bill
1. The bill as written would cut the pool of individuals that would be eligible to serve
2. This is a statewide board not just a Cook Inlet Board
3. What knowledge would three PU/subsistence users seats bring to the table
4. Commercial fisheries are the largest private sector employer in the state and two is not enough
5. This does not solve the problem - a professional board is needed
6. MOst permit holders in AYK are subsistence and commercial and would not be able to serve
7. People with cross over experience would not be able to serve
8. Requirement that sport and PU/Subsistence seats may not have a family member with even a commercial crew license is too restrictive
9. Subsistence community does not feel that they can be represented by PU representatives
10. This bill does not include tender contracts among the items that would disqualify someone from sport or PU/subsistence seat.
11. Divisive - the resultant board would likely be more fractionalized, and it is not clear how the stated makeup would help the board make good decisions
12. This is a reaction to allocation decisions - what problem does this solve?

Also if you read this far, the Governor announced her Board of Fish appointments today with the re-appointment of John Jensen and Mel Morris and appointment of William Brown of Juneau (sportfisherman)
